Improve errors when MAS contacts the Synapse homeserver (#2794)
* Add some drive-by docstrings * Change text rendering of catch_http_codes::HttpError Using `#[source]` is unnatural here because it makes it look like two distinct errors (one being a cause of the other), when in reality it is just one error, with 2 parts. Using `Display` formatting for that leads to a more natural error. * Add constraints to `catch_http_code{,s}` methods Not strictly required, but does two things: - documents what kind of function is expected - provides a small extra amount of type enforcement at the call site, rather than later on when you find the result doesn't implement Service * Add a `catch_http_errors` shorthand Nothing major, just a quality of life improvement so you don't have to repetitively write out what a HTTP error is * Unexpected error page: remove leading whitespace from preformatted 'details' section The extra whitespace was probably unintentional and makes the error harder to read, particularly when it wraps onto a new line unnecessarily * Capture and log Matrix errors received from Synapse * Drive-by clippy fix: use clamp instead of min().max() * Convert `err(Display)` to `err(Debug)` for `anyhow::Error`s in matrix-synapse support module
